Reducing Carbon Footprint With Innovative Materials

While tax incentives and rebates offer considerable financial advantages, the environmental benefits of eco-friendly roofing materials are just as compelling. By choosing roofs made from biodegradable materials, you actively reduce your carbon footprint. These materials break down naturally, minimizing waste and pollution.

Innovative technologies in roofing have also transformed how we think about sustainability. For instance, solar shingles not only provide energy but also contribute to lowering emissions by harnessing the sun’s power. Additionally, cool roofs reflect more sunlight, markedly reducing heat absorption and cooling costs.

Are There Any Specific Installation Techniques for Green Roofing?

When installing green roofs, you’ll face specific challenges based on the type.

Intensive green roofs, with deeper soil layers, need reinforced structures due to the added weight. Extensive green roofs, being lighter, are easier but require precise drainage systems.

Guarantee proper waterproof membranes to prevent leaks. Pay attention to plant selection and maintenance requirements.

Each green roof type demands careful planning to address these installation challenges efficiently. Proper installation guarantees longevity and effectiveness.

What Is the Lifespan Comparison With Traditional Roofing Materials?

When you compare eco-friendly roofing materials to traditional ones, you’ll find that their lifespan durability often matches or even exceeds that of conventional options.

Eco-friendly options like metal, slate, or recycled materials offer incredible durability and material sustainability. They can last 50 years or more, reducing the need for frequent replacements.
